This hands‑on role places you at the heart of maintaining a safe, welcoming, and fully functional environment for our pupils and staff. You’ll take professional ownership of your trade while supporting the wider maintenance team in everything from routine upkeep to urgent repairs. Your expertise will be key to ensuring our school buildings, equipment, and grounds meet the highest standards of safety and functionality.
Responsibilities- Take charge of your specialist trade or area of expertise, delivering high‑quality maintenance and repairs.
- Assist the maintenance team with both planned projects and reactive tasks.
- Conduct regular site inspections to spot and resolve Health & Safety concerns.
- Advise staff on the safe use and maintenance of machinery and equipment.
- Support risk assessments and ensure compliance with COSHH and other regulations.
- Maintain tools and equipment, keeping everything in top condition.
- Travel across the school site and to suppliers as needed.
- GCSE Maths & English at level 4 or above.
- Proven experience in facilities management or a relevant trade (plumbing, joinery, electrical, decorating, etc.).
- Strong knowledge of Health & Safety and compliance standards.
- Ability to work independently with initiative, but also collaborate effectively within a team.
- Excellent problem‑solving skills and clear communication.
- Flexibility and responsiveness to urgent maintenance needs.
- Driving licence required.
